The European Central Bank Governing Council member Jens Weidmann said on Tuesday that concerns over the deflation in the Eurozone dissipated.
"Worries about deflation, which were then exaggerated, have further dissipated," he said.
Weidmann pointed out that an accommodative monetary policy is needed in the Eurozone.
"Therefore a normalization of monetary policy in the Eurozone is currently not on the agenda," he noted.
